Output 521bf947f6ed7341eba1b6826d1b2c7f7b3cc1cb2ece4128a882242a74d9fe61:2

value
13035594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 247918302ee62742411a55da6f9f9025e0a91700 OP_EQUAL
address
351sKEzHw3VNGvCkcLgh1DE6PeEsJWkHN2
transaction
521bf947f6ed7341eba1b6826d1b2c7f7b3cc1cb2ece4128a882242a74d9fe61
confirmations
459671
spent
true